In the current four day cricket match between New South Wales and South Australia at the Sydney Cricket Ground, the South Australians equalled an unenviable record set twice before in the history of Australian first class domestic competition. What was it?

Six bastmen were out for a duck. The other two occasions were:
Their sextet of ducks matched the six by NSW against SA at the SCG in 1932/33, when Don Bradman top-scored with 56 in a total of 113 and fast bowler Tim Wall took 10-36; and South Australia's six against Queensland at the Gabba in 1976/77, when Jeff Thomson finished with 5-32 in a total of 96.
